What is an Adjustable Standing Workstation?
An adjustable standing workstation is a desk or work surface that allows users to switch between sitting and standing positions throughout the workday. These workstations usually have a mechanism for height modification, whether manual or electric, allowing users to find their ideal ergonomics while working.

Kinds Of Adjustable Standing Workstations
When picking an adjustable standing workstation, there are a number of types to think about:
Manual Adjustable Desks: These desks need users to change the height by hand, typically utilizing a lever or a crank. They are typically more affordable but may be less practical for regular changes.
Electric Adjustable Desks: These desks include electric motors that permit users to change the height with the push of a button. They use ease of usage for quick transitions between sitting and standing.
Desktop Converters: These gadgets sit on top of existing desks and can be raised or decreased to develop a standing workstation. They are a cost-effective choice for those who wish to try standing while working without investing in a new desk.
Convertible Workstations: These workstations can change in between a conventional desk and a standing desk, providing the very best of both worlds. They frequently have sophisticated styles that stabilize looks and performance.
L-Shaped and Corner Desks: For those with bigger offices, L-shaped or corner adjustable desks offer ample room for multiple monitors and equipment while offering adjustable height features.

Secret Considerations When Choosing a Standing Workstation
When selecting the ideal adjustable standing workstation, a number of factors ought to be thought about:
Height Range: Choose a workstation with a height variety appropriate for your body size to guarantee an ergonomic fit.
Stability: Look for a workstation that remains stable when completely reached prevent discomfort or safety dangers.
Weight Capacity: Ensure the desk can support your devices and personal items without jeopardizing stability.
Reduce of Adjustment: The mechanism for changing the height should be easy to use, especially if regular modifications are anticipated.
Aesthetic appeals: Consider the style and design of the workstation to ensure it fits within your office decor.
Price Point: Determine your spending plan and discover the very best choices within that range, balancing quality and expense.
Often Asked Questions (FAQ)
1. How frequently should I switch between sitting and standing?
It is usually advised to alternate in between sitting and standing every 30 to 60 minutes. Listening to your body is vital; if you feel fatigued, consider altering your position.
2. Can standing desks lower pain in the back?
Numerous users report decreased pain in the back after utilizing standing desks, as they promote better posture and spinal alignment. Nevertheless, proper ergonomics need to be kept to take full advantage of benefits.
3. Are adjustable standing desks expensive?
Rates can differ commonly based on functions, products, and brand name. While manual desks can be affordable, electric designs tend to be more pricey. It's possible to find quality options at numerous rate points.
4. Is it safe to use an adjustable standing workstation?
Yes, adjustable standing workstations are safe when used properly. Guarantee your setup follows ergonomic guidelines, such as ensuring monitors are at eye level and keeping wrists in a neutral position while typing.
5. Are there any disadvantages to utilizing a standing desk?
While adjustable standing desks provide numerous benefits, extended standing can result in discomfort in the legs and feet. Including anti-fatigue mats and taking routine breaks can help reduce this.
